‘I must go down to the sea again‘, wrote John Masefield in 1902, ‘To the gull’s way and the whale’s way...’ How many of us have felt that pull? The longing to be where the sky meets the ocean and dreams are possible. That place where the bird calls always sound different; even the plants look slightly alien and, if we are fortunate, we may get a glimpse of the whale’s way.~ HELEN M. STEVENS
The delicate little tern (Sternula albifons) is one of the smallest of its species and can hover with all the skill and grace of a hummingbird.
Sea holly (Eryngium maritimum), as the name suggests, has leaves as prickly as its inland namesake, though much more spectacular flowers.
